Java服務(wù)器端時間差實現(xiàn)數(shù)據(jù)處理,一站式解決您的需求!
本文將闡述如何使用Java服務(wù)器端時間差實現(xiàn)數(shù)據(jù)處理,為中心,一站式解決您的需求!通過分成4個方面進行詳細闡述,讓您了解如何在Java服務(wù)器端使用時間差來處理數(shù)據(jù)。
1、時間差概述
時間差表示從一個時間到另一個時間的差異。在Java服務(wù)器端,我們常用時間戳來表示時間,這是一個從1970年1月1日開始計算的毫秒數(shù)。如果要比較兩個時間戳,我們可以使用Java提供的Date類或Calendar類。在使用時間差進行數(shù)據(jù)處理時,我們可以通過比較時間戳的差值來實現(xiàn)。我們可以計算出兩個事件戳的差值,并將其轉(zhuǎn)化為時間單位或格式(如秒、小時或日期時間格式)。這樣,我們就可以使用這個時間差來進行數(shù)據(jù)處理。
2、時間戳的計算
在Java中,我們可以使用System.currentTimeMillis()方法獲取當(dāng)前時間戳。如果我們有兩個時間戳,我們可以使用它們的差來計算它們之間的時間差(以毫秒為單位)。另一種方法是使用Calendar類。您可以使用Calendar.getInstance()方法獲取當(dāng)前Calendar對象。然后,您可以使用set()方法設(shè)置要比較的日期和時間。最后,您可以使用getTimeInMillis()方法獲取時間戳。
使用Calendar類計算時間差比使用Date類更具可讀性,因為它可以使用更有意義的常量來設(shè)置日期,如Calendar.DAY_OF_MONTH或Calendar.HOUR_OF_DAY。
3、時間差的格式化
在Java中,我們可以使用SimpleDateFormat類將時間差格式化為我們需要的任何格式。例如,您可以將時間差格式化為“小時:分鐘:秒”或“日/月/年時:分鐘:秒”等格式。格式化時間差的關(guān)鍵是找到適合您數(shù)據(jù)需求的日期時間格式。這可能需要一些嘗試和錯誤,但Java提供了許多日期時間格式選項和指南。
4、時間差的應(yīng)用
時間差廣泛應(yīng)用于Java服務(wù)器端中各種類型的數(shù)據(jù)處理,例如:
- 時間戳的比較和排序
- 計算程序的運行時間
- 計算兩個事件之間的時間差
- 計算兩個人之間的年齡差
- 確定文件或日志條目創(chuàng)建時間
實際應(yīng)用中,時間差可以與其他數(shù)據(jù)計算和處理技術(shù)結(jié)合使用,從而使您的Java服務(wù)器端應(yīng)用程序更具效益和功能。
總之,Java服務(wù)器端時間差可以幫助您處理數(shù)據(jù),并提供有用的信息。無論您要比較時間戳,計算時間差還是格式化它,時間差都是Java服務(wù)器端處理數(shù)據(jù)的強大工具。
本文闡述了Java服務(wù)器端時間差的基礎(chǔ)知識和應(yīng)用。無論您是Java服務(wù)器端開發(fā)人員還是任何其他需要處理數(shù)據(jù)的人員,本文都可以為您提供幫助和指導(dǎo)。